Impression of the Universe

For thousands of years, people saw the Earth as the centre of the Universe and humans as the pinnacle of creation. The 16th-century work of Polish astronomer Nicolaus Copernicus changed all that. Since then, we have come to realise that we are a very recent species, living on an insignificant planet — cosmic newcomers in a remote corner of the Universe. Astronomy (as well as geology and evolutionary biology) has given us a completely different view of ourselves that has significantly altered the way we treat our planet, our fellow human beings and other lifeforms on planet Earth.
